Is Cesars Pizza House halal certified?

Cesars Pizza House is widely considered halal by the local community. They are a family-owned business that proudly serves a 100% halal menu and is known for being an alcohol-free establishment. While they may not have a formal paper certificate, their practices and community trust confirm their commitment to providing halal food.

Do they serve alcohol or pork?

No, Cesars Pizza House does not serve any pork products. They are also an alcohol-free restaurant, so you won't find any alcoholic beverages on the premises.

Is the meat hand slaughtered (zabihah)?

We haven't found specific information confirming that all meat is hand-slaughtered. For peace of mind, it's always a good idea to ask the staff directly about their meat suppliers.

Are there prayer facilities nearby?

While the restaurant doesn't have its own prayer room, Al Madina Musallah is conveniently located nearby at 190 Waldron Rd, just a 3-minute walk away. Wudu facilities are available there.
